What dex_token_info does on Logiqical

AI agents call dex_token_info to retrieve information from Logiqical without modifying anything — typically the context-gathering step in research, monitoring, and reporting workflows, before the agent takes action elsewhere.

Why dex_token_info needs a policy

This tool retrieves token information from a decentralized exchange without modifying, executing, or deleting any data. It is a straightforward read operation that returns metadata about tokens. The blast radius of misuse is minimal, as an agent cannot cause harm by looking up token information.

From the tool's definition Tool description explicitly states 'Look up any ERC-20 token by contract address' — a query operation with no side effects.

Questions about dex_token_info

What does the dex_token_info tool do? +

Look up any ERC-20 token by contract address. It is categorised as a Read tool in the Logiqical MCP Server, which means it retrieves data without modifying state.

How do I enforce a policy on dex_token_info? +

Register the Logiqical M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for dex_token_info: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ches Logiqical. Nothing to install.

What risk level is dex_token_info? +

dex_token_info is a Read tool with low risk. Read-only tools are generally safe to allow by default.

Can I rate-limit dex_token_info?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the dex_token_info r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block dex_token_info complet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for dex_token_info.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.

What MCP server provides dex_token_info? +

dex_token_info is provided by the Logiqical MCP server (logiqical-mcp-server). PolicyLayer sits as a proxy in front of this server to enforce policies before tool calls reach the server.
